Dear Sir or Madam,

I am a third-year bachelor's student at the Faculty of Biology in Saint Petersburg State University, and I am writing this letter to apply to your summer program.

I decided to be a biologist when I was in high school because I realized that biology is a science in which breakthroughs are fundamental in all aspects of our life. My love of biology increased at university because, with advances in modern technology, biology can open a vast array of opportunities. For example, when I attended the Bioinformatic Summer School in 2017, I learned first-hand that programming is a perfect match for biology. This knowledge was important for me due to my love of molecular biology and my goal of pursuing a career which combines both disciplines. As a result, I successfully completed several courses on programming and have been participating in programming clubs.

Furthermore, I am always interested in broadening my knowledge in fields such as genetics, biochemistry, histology, and cytology. I believe they are relevant and appropriate to build up my career in science.

For the past 5 years, I have been one of the five winners of the all-Russia “I am a Professional” competition, in the area of biotechnology. I have also written and published a few popular scientific articles.

The more I read about the National Institute of Genetics, the more I love this institute. NIG really impacts modern science, and the greatest scientists from NIG, e.g name1, name2, name3, and others are highly renowned and respected in the scientific community. The faculty interviewers strongly motivated me not only by the very interesting scientific topics and achievements discussed, but also by their human qualities, including their motivation, goodwill, and absolute dedication to their field of research.

I am very interested in laboratory laboratory, and I think that it is very important to understand the principles of molecular evolution and population genetics at the level of both bioinformatics and genetics because it can lead scientists to many discoveries crucial for understanding the evolution and co-evolution, phylogeny, gene expression and protein evolution. I am convinced that my goals to develop my programming skills and my absolutely love of molecular biology and genetics can be translated into successful laboratory research work. I believe that I will be able to gain the invaluable experience necessary for my future career in science after attending the summer practice and working in your laboratory, as well as the useful skills and knowledge of molecular evolution, population genetics, and bioinformatics.

I am convinced that NIGINTERN will be an indispensable experience for me, and I am strongly motivated to succeed at NIG.

Thank you for considering my application, and I look forward to your positive response.

Yours faithfully,

Maria Fyodorova
